JEE PYQ: Oscillations Question 14

Question 14 - 2021 (25 Feb 2021 Shift 2)

$Y = A\sin(\omega t + \phi_0)$ is the time-displacement equation of a SHM. At $t = 0$ the displacement of the particle is $Y = \frac{A}{2}$ and it is moving along negative $x$-direction. Then the initial phase angle $\phi_0$ will be:

(1) $\frac{\pi}{6}$

(2) $\frac{\pi}{3}$

(3) $\frac{5\pi}{6}$

(4) $\frac{2\pi}{3}$
